Chelsea fans think they spotted Fabinho doing something disgusting to Eden Hazard

Chelsea had an afternoon to forget as their top four hopes were dealt a blow by a 2-0 defeat at Liverpool .

The Reds struck a quick-fire second half double to down Maurizio Sarri's side, with Eden Hazard missing a couple of chances to get them back into the game.

Hazard had a rough afternoon as he was on the receiving end of some rough treatment in the first half having been isolated in a central role.

He went down and received treatment after a kick on the ankle just 10 minutes into the game - and eagle-eyed Chelsea fans think they spotted something disgusting done by Fabinho as he was on the deck.

A clip posted on social media shows midfielder Fabinho clearing his nose, with the camera angle appearing to show him stepping forward towards Hazard before doing so.

It led to the clip being circulated on Twitter , with fans branding him "Flobinho" and stating it was "embarrassing" and deserved a "10 game ban".

The incident took place right in front of referee Michael Oliver, prompting people to note it "must be a weird angle" otherwise the "ref would have sent him off".

Others insisted it was "nowhere near" the stricken Hazard as he underwent treatment from the physio and was fit to continue the game.

But the incident certainly got people on social media talking, with Fabinho going on to play a crucial role in a vital Liverpool win.

A quick-fire second half double with goals from Sadio Mane and Mohamed Salah saw Jurgen Klopp's side retake the lead in the Premier League table.

They are two points ahead of Manchester City with the race for the top prize hotting up in the closing stages of the season.
